Dette er litt av et vanskelig spørsmål, da det avhenger av hvordan du definerer "karakter".
Her er et sammenbrudd:
* byte vs. tegn: En byte er den grunnleggende enheten for datalagring. En karakter kan være representert med en enkelt byte (f.eks. ASCII -tegn) eller flere byte (f.eks. Unicode -tegn).
* 8 GB RAM: 8 GB (gigabyte) RAM tilsvarer 8.000.000.000 byte.
Scenario 1:Forutsatt 1 byte per tegn (ASCII)
* 8 GB RAM kunne lagre 8 000 000 000 tegn.
Scenario 2:Forutsatt 2 byte per tegn (Unicode)
* 8 GB RAM kunne lagre 4 000 000 000 tegn.
Scenario 3:Forutsatt 4 byte per tegn (noen Unicode -tegn)
* 8 GB RAM kunne lagre 2.000.000.000.000 tegn.
Viktig merknad: RAM brukes til aktivt kjørende programmer og data. Det brukes vanligvis ikke til langvarig lagring av store mengder tekst. For det vil du bruke en harddisk eller SSD.